Restores the selected region in an image using the region neighborhood.
void inpaint(InputArray src, InputArray inpaintMask, OutputArray dst, double inpaintRadius, int flags)¶ cv2.inpaint(src, inpaintMask, inpaintRadius, flags[, dst]) → dst¶ void cvInpaint(const CvArr* src, const CvArr* inpaint_mask, CvArr* dst, double inpaintRange, int flags)¶ cv.Inpaint(src, mask, dst, inpaintRadius, flags) → None¶| Parameters: |

The function reconstructs the selected image area from the pixel near the area boundary. The function may be used to remove dust and scratches from a scanned photo, or to remove undesirable objects from still images or video. See http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Inpainting for more details.
